About

Welcome! 👋🏻

I’m a software engineer with over 15 years of experience in creating secure, scalable, and interconnected systems. My passion lies in simplifying the complexities of software integration—bringing diverse technologies together to build seamless, reliable, and high-performing solutions.

Doing CrossFit: my hobby and therapy

What I Do?

In today’s interconnected world, integration is at the heart of every successful system. I specialize in bridging the gaps between technologies, making systems work smarter together. My expertise includes:

Testing for Confidence
Ensuring seamless connections through contract and integration testing.

Integration Types
REST APIs, synchronous and asynchronous systems.

Messaging
Building robust, event-driven systems with tools like Kafka and RabbitMQ.

Security
Designing secure integrations using OAuth2, OpenID Connect, and more.

Patterns and Real Cases
Applying integration patterns and solving real-world challenges, including high-volume and high-performance scenarios.

Why Software Integration?

The modern software landscape is a mix of tools, platforms, and protocols. Integration isn’t just about making connections—it’s about enabling systems to communicate efficiently, scale seamlessly, and deliver their full potential. Whether I’m working with APIs, event-driven systems, or security layers, my goal is to make integration simpler and more effective.

How I Share My Knowledge?

Through my blog and other content, I aim to make software integration accessible for developers of all levels. My focus is on actionable insights, practical solutions, and real-world use cases to help you master integration challenges.

Let’s Connect!

If you’re interested in software integration or looking for ways to improve your systems, I’d love to connect! Send me an e-mail, subscribe to my newsletter, or reach out via LinkedIn.